JAVA程序设计 课程设计(QQ个人资料论文)
(1)掌握Java编程、面向对象的基础知识。 (2)较熟练地编写Java应用程序Application。 (3)了解Java的常用标准类库、编程技巧、异常处理。 (5)联系已学过的内容,巩固所学的理论,增强独立工作能力。 (6)通过设计主要使学生有一个独立编写程序的过程,对理论学习及动手能力都有一个很大的提高。 (7)通过本次设计,进一步培养学生热爱专业的思想,同时对本专业综合素质的提高起一个积极的推动作用。 《JAVA程序设计》课程设计,特别是以QQ个人资料为主题的项目,旨在深化学生对Java编程语言的理解,提升他们的编程技能,并锻炼他们的独立工作能力。以下是基于标题、描述和部分内容的关键知识点和详细说明: 1. **Java编程基础知识**:这包括了解Java语法、变量、数据类型、控制结构(如if-else,for,while循环)、方法定义和调用等基本概念。学生应能熟练运用这些知识来编写简单的Java程序。 2. **面向对象编程**:面向对象是Java的核心特性,学生需要掌握类、对象、封装、继承、多态等概念。能够设计和实现具有实际功能的对象模型是这个阶段的重要目标。 3. **Java应用程序Application**:Java应用程序是指独立运行的程序,通常从main()方法开始执行。学生应能编写能够读取输入、处理逻辑并输出结果的Java应用程序。 4. **Java标准类库**:了解和使用Java提供的标准类库,如java.util包中的集合框架(ArrayList, HashMap等),java.io包中的输入/输出流,以及java.lang包中的基本类,是提升编程效率的关键。 5. **编程技巧和异常处理**:熟练掌握异常处理机制(try-catch-finally块),理解并使用异常类,能够编写更健壮的代码。同时,了解和运用一些编程最佳实践,如代码复用、减少冗余、提高可读性等。 6. **理论联系实践**:通过实际编程项目,将课堂上学习的理论知识付诸实践,巩固抽象概念,增强对知识的实际运用能力。 7. **独立编写程序**:设计项目让学生经历完整的编程流程,包括需求分析、设计、编码、测试和调试,这有助于提升他们的独立解决问题的能力。 8. **热爱专业与综合素质**:此设计不仅是技术训练,也是对学生专业热情的培养,同时通过实际操作提升他们的综合素质,包括团队协作、时间管理、文档编写等能力。 在课程设计中,学生需要按照指导教师的要求,完成从需求分析到程序编写,再到异常处理和程序测试的全过程。此外,他们还需要撰写课程设计报告,详细记录设计过程、遇到的问题及解决方案,以及程序的功能和运行效果。这不仅检验了学生的编程技能,也锻炼了他们的书面表达和反思能力。 这个课程设计是一个综合性的学习体验,旨在全面提高学生的Java编程能力和专业素养,为他们未来的职业生涯打下坚实的基础。




























剩余19页未读,继续阅读


- 粉丝: 0
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- ctoc电子商务专题知识讲座.pptx
- C语言第7讲关系运算与逻辑运算if语句.ppt
- 基于单片机温度控制系统的设计.doc
- 基于AT89C52单片机的温室控制系统.doc
- 专题讲座资料(2021-2022年)单片机的红外防盗报警器.doc
- 购物网站策划书.doc
- 基于数据挖掘技术的负荷预测及主动设备维护可行性研究报告.doc
- 计算机教研组工作总结(2023年2023年第一学期).docx
- 【源版】第五章-数据库技术基础.ppt
- 工厂数字化网络监控系统解决方案.doc
- 网络谣言的传播与成因.ppt
- 基于GPS车辆跟踪系统的移动对象数据库应用研究.doc
- 光纤通信(第5版)课后习题答案要点.doc
- 高中数学第1章算法初步章末复习与总结课件新人教A版必修.ppt
- 网络研修学习总结.doc
- 中小型企业网站建设方案模板.doc


